Experience: Has performed at some of the Worlds most prestigious events both in the UK and abroad. These include five televised Royal Edinburgh Military Tattoos, two Basel Tattoos in Switzerland and the 69th & 70th Commemorations of Operation Market Garden in Arnhem. Whilst based in the Greater Glasgow area, she is happy to travel to perform at weddings and special events from the Ayrshire to Aberdeenshire as needed. When not performing for events, she enjoys competing with her pipe band in Glasgow at the five major championships (World, European, UK, British and Scottish Championships).

Weddings.

Before the Ceremony
The bagpipes can be used to help fill in the void as guests leave the wedding and gather outside before heading to the reception. Music can be played outside as guests mingle after the wedding and when photographs are being taken. If the reception is within easy walking distance, the bagpiper can lead the procession to the reception facility. This is a great way to make your event extra special.

During the Ceremony
Music can be played during the signing of the register.

At the end of the service

The bagpipes are a great way to add excitement to the recessional. Newlywed couples can make a Grand Exit with pipe music playing as they are introduced and lead them back down the aisle.
